Output d89784cb1aaea1b523a6578ad5794352b006b003a68f420b8e42c9e3921a42f6:0

value
17403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d42bc8b9ea653c735a0f9081a53b518781eadf OP_EQUAL
address
34mtPmxJFgW88Xh94hRkePG4qjWCUxWxCx
transaction
d89784cb1aaea1b523a6578ad5794352b006b003a68f420b8e42c9e3921a42f6
spent
true